Steve Blank On Making Lean Startups Out Of Scientists

It’s no stretch that Steve Blank’s students and mentees refer to him as one of “the Godfathers of Silicon Valley.” Blank’s methodology of Customer Development is the building block on which Eric Ries’ Lean Startup movement is built; in fact, Blank calls Ries, “The best student I’ve ever had.” With over thirty years of experience in the high technology industry, three books, a wildly successful blog and eight startups under his belt, Blank has moved into the next phase of his brilliance: creating highly accessible NSF-funded entrepreneurial curriculum to train scientists and engineers across the country.
